No: sorry, but that's silly, of course. A dictionary's purpose is to
help readers understand what they find - correct or incorrect. So any
dictionary worth its salt will indeed list common wrong versions as
well as correct ones. They are descriptive and don't provide any
imprimatur. As someone memorably said, "_Fliegerabwehrkanone_ has
nineteen letters, none of which is a C"!
